#!/bin/bash # Version 0.1 - initial start of this localcheck # Installation # This file should be place on a/the fusionauth host in /usr/lib/check_mk_agent/local # # (optional) if you want the check to run on a different schedule (like once per hour) put it in a subdirectory of above path # named to the number of seconds of the interval wanted, so 3600/ for once an hour, 86400 for once per day. # # Also do not forget to make this file executable with chmod +x /usr/lib/check_mk_agent/local/fusionauth.sh # (c) Michael Honkoop # License: GNU General Public License v2 RELEASEURL="https://license.fusionauth.io/api/latest-version" FUSIONAUTH_VERSION_AVAIL=$(curl -s --connect-timeout 5 --fail-with-body $RELEASEURL) if [ -z "$FUSIONAUTH_VERSION_AVAIL" ]; then echo "1 \"FusionAuth\" - No data received from release-URL, can not determine latest release-version" exit 0 fi mapfile -t fusionauth_packages < <(rpm -qa 'fusionauth*') outdated_packages=() for package in "${fusionauth_packages[@]}"; do if [[ "$package" != *"$FUSIONAUTH_VERSION_AVAIL"* ]]; then outdated_packages+=("$package") fi done if [ ${#outdated_packages[@]} -eq 0 ]; then echo "0 \"FusionAuth\" - All FusionAuth packages are up to date ($FUSIONAUTH_VERSION_AVAIL)" else echo "1 \"FusionAuth\" - Update required for: ${outdated_packages[*]}" fi
